Locating a dependable door contractor needs careful research and factor to consider. Here are some steps to help in finding the ideal contractor for your job:

Ask for Recommendations: Begin your search by asking pals, family, or next-door neighbors for referrals. Individual experiences can provide valuable insights.

Online Research: Utilize websites like Yelp, Angie's List, or Google Reviews to read reviews and reviews from previous clients.

Inspect Credentials: Ensure the contractor holds the essential licenses and insurance coverage. This secures you in case of mishaps or damages during the job.

Interview Contractors: Speak with numerous contractors to assess their experience, competence, and interaction design. Ask about their technique to the specific work you need done.

Demand Estimates: Obtain comprehensive written price quotes from a few contractors to compare prices and scope of work. Make sure these quotes break down the costs of products and labor.

Review Contracts: Carefully checked out through all agreements before finalizing. Search for clearness on timelines, payment schedules, warranties, and contingencies.
Frequently Asked Questions (FAQs)What should I consider when picking door materials?
Selecting door materials includes thinking about aspects such as security, toughness, insulation properties, and visual appeals. Typical products include wood, fiberglass, metal, and composite, each with benefits and drawbacks.
For how long does door installation typically take?
The period of door installation varies based on factors like the type of door and any additional work required (e.g., customizing the frame). Generally, a standard door installation can draw from a few hours to a full day.
Is it worth working with a door specialist for small repairs?
Yes, even minor repairs can benefit from a contractor's know-how. Attempting DIY repairs may result in additional issues if not done correctly, while a professional will ensure an appropriate and lasting fix.
Do door contractors provide guarantees on their work?
Lots of reputable contractors provide service warranties on their installations. This assurance can vary from a few months to several years, depending upon the contractor and kind of work performed.
How can I ensure my project stays within spending plan?
To manage your budget, make sure clear communication with your professional relating to costs. Request a detailed breakdown of estimated expenditures and preserve a contingency fund for unforeseen issues.
